Maersk and CMA CGM Start New Oceania Route Space Charter Cooperation
Logistics News
18-Dec-2025
Recently, Maersk announced that it will provide capacity to CMA CGM on the Oceania route through a charter party agreement from January 026, continuing to focus highly on providing high-quality, stable, and reliable services with a guaranteed weekly slot.
In addition, Maersk stated that it continue to own and operate the Oceania route service in full.
After two years of the Red Sea crisis, large container lines generally face multiple pressures, such as forced extendedages, rising fuel and time costs, and persistent weak freight rates. Slot charter cooperation may, to some extent, become one of the effective means for shipping companies to alleviate cost pressures
